Home window installation services involve replacing or upgrading existing windows or installing new windows in residential properties. These projects can include replacing old, drafty, or damaged windows with energy-efficient models, installing custom-sized windows for new additions, or upgrading to styles that enhance curb appeal and natural light. Property owners often want to understand the different window styles available, such as double-hung, casement, or picture windows, as well as the materials used and the benefits of energy-efficient options. Clarifying the scope of work, including any necessary modifications to the window openings, helps ensure the project aligns with the homeowner’s goals and property requirements.
Before requesting window installation services, homeowners typically consider factors like the type of windows that best suit their home's architecture, the expected improvements in insulation and energy savings, and any aesthetic preferences. It’s also helpful to understand the overall process, including measurements, removal of existing windows, and the installation timeline. Property owners should inquire about the compatibility of new windows with existing frames, the potential need for permits, and any maintenance considerations. Gathering this information helps ensure a smooth project and a final result that meets both functional and visual expectations.

Common Home Window Installation Jobs
Casement Windows - ideal for providing excellent ventilation and unobstructed views.
Double-Hung Windows - popular for easy cleaning and versatile operation.
Picture Windows - large, fixed panes that maximize natural light and scenic views.
Bay and Bow Windows - create additional interior space and enhance curb appeal.
Sliding Windows - offer convenient opening and smooth operation for everyday use.
Energy-Efficient Windows - designed to improve insulation and reduce heating and cooling costs.
Home Window Installation Questions
What types of windows are suitable for installation? Various options include double-hung, casement, and picture windows, suitable for different styles and functional needs.
Can windows be installed in existing frames? Yes, many installations involve fitting new windows into existing frames, depending on their condition and size.
What should homeowners consider before replacing windows? Factors include energy efficiency, window style, and the compatibility with the property's architecture.
Is it possible to customize window sizes and designs? Custom options are available to match specific measurements and aesthetic preferences for each property.
